Normally I wouldn't have a problem with this task. I would wear my torags and veracs with FSH etc, y'know general slayer stuff. Take 2 unis, loads of scrolls, and my cannon.

 

However, I have some questions.

 

A. Which style is best? Slash or what?

B. Should I block them?

Crush annihilates living rock creatures; think of a weapon you would use for waterfiends and use it there.

 

Blocking them is a tough choice, I know a lot of people with them blocked and a lot who don't; I would say try out one task and see how much you/dislike them and choose after.

Whip + defender seems to rip through them as well, I don't think they're strong enough for the weakness to really mean anything. Turmoil also shows they got 0 defense (level).

I would definitely not block them. Pretty sure they're the fastest melee xp of any task, or if not the fastest, then at least right there near the top. They also have great drops, they're fast slayer xp, and they have low attack and defense. They're not great for charms and the slayer points are fairly slow, but otherwise they're quite good.

 

Piety and cannon are both good ways to speed up the task. If you're not using both, then I'd just use piety, but there's no reason why you couldn't use both.

 

Whip + defender is fine. The crush weakness doesn't matter much because their defense is so low to begin with.
